Discover how you can make a difference in the lives of individuals, families and communities around the world.*** Please note this is a 12-month contract ***The Digital Mail Services Administrator works on a team to ensure effective digital imaging, accurate data-entry, and precision routing of sensitive documents. The successful candidate will be responsible for learning and applying our processes and upholding our standards in a fast-paced onsite production environment. Regular work hours are 3:30PM-11:30PM, Monday through Friday.What will you do

  • Digitizing documents using commercial scanning machines
  • Importing and organizing digital files, keying data on scanned documents, and routing them to our internal partners
  • Participating actively in regular meetings, projects, professional development, and coursework
  • Ensuring that each document is handled with care and diligence
  • Learning our processes and policies quickly and effectively
  • Meeting our performance standards within an established time frame
What you need to succeed
  • Physically capable of performing repetitive motions, operating scanners and computers at a fast pace every day
  • Experience with reading, learning and applying structured processes
  • Ability to work independently with minimal direction and frequent interruptions
  • Communication skills, attention to detail and ability to maintain a high level of productivity
What is nice to have
  • Experience using Microsoft Office software, Windows, Outlook, SharePoint, OneDrive, OneNote and Excel
  • Experience doing repetitive work for extended periods
  • Experience meeting/exceeding performance expectations in production environments
Notes/Unique Requirements:
  • Digital Mail Services operates Monday through Friday, 3:30 PM–11:30 PM
  • This role involves physical tasks which are of a repetitive nature
  • Successful completion of RCMP criminal background check is required
  • Successful obtainment of Government Reliability Status (two valid photo ID’s, and digital fingerprinting) is required
